Florida Department of Health to Open Pediatric Health Clinics in St. Pete

Two new pediatric health clinics open in St. Pete Monday.

The Florida Department of Health is opening two new pediatric clinics in St. Petersburg today.

According to a news release the clinics will be located at the Pinellas Health Center 205.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. S and at Northeast High School, 5500 16th St. N. 

The Florida Department of Health said the Northeast clinic will also provide medical care to uninsured adults.

The pediatric clinic at 205 Dr. MLK Jr St. N will be open from 8:30 a.m. - 5:30 p.m. Monday through Friday. The Northeast High clinic will be open from 2:30-5:30 p.m. Monday through Friday.
